Moto Solar
Marinus Rd, Eldoraigne, Centurion, 0157
+27768232439
Features
Map
Similar companies
Solar energy company
Afrenergy
42 Currie St, Oaklands, Johannesburg, 2192
+27117288530
Solar energy company
MLT Power - George (Pty) Ltd
George Industria, George, 6536
0879432299
Solar energy company
Moto Solar
Kenilworth St, Kyalami, Midrand, 1632
0768232439
Solar energy company
Moto Solar
Lower Park Dr, Parkview, Johannesburg, 2092
+27768232439